#ddb4c2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#ddb4c2 is composed of 86.7% red, 70.6% green and 76.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 18.6% magenta, 12.2% yellow and 13.3% black. It has a hue angle of 339.5 degrees, a saturation of 37.6% and a lightness of 78.6%. #ddb4c2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#bb6985.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

● #ddb4c2 color description : Light grayish pink.
#ddb4c2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#ddb4c2 has RGB values of R:221, G:180, B:194 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.19, Y:0.12, K:0.13. Its decimal value is 14529730.
